Synonyms: vascular endothelial growth factor A | vascular permeability factor (VPF) | VEGF-A
Comment: The active peptide is anti-parallel homodimer linked by disulphide bonds. VEGFA exists as four isoforms of 121, 165, 189 and 206 amino acids. The shortest variant contains the full VEGFR2 binding site but lacks domains that are involved in interactions with extracellular-matrix and co-receptors which are present in the longer isoforms [14-15].
A recombinant single-chain derivative of VEGFA121 (scVEGF) can be used experimentally as a fully functional peptide that binds and activates VEGFR2 in the same manner as endogenous VEGFA [1]. scVEGF can be labelled with a single fluorophore at its N-terminal, for use as a molecular probe [3].

Post-translational Modification
Homodimer formed by interchain disulphide bonds between cysteine residues at positions 51 and 60; further disulphide bonds formed between cysteine residues at positions 26 and 68, 57 and 102, and 61 and 104. Lysine residues at positions 121, 123 and 126 are N6-acetyllysine. N-linked glycosylation of asparagine residue at position 75
